The overall performance of hair care in the Netherlands in 2020 appears to be not dissimilar to the previous year. However, COVID-19 impacted individual categories of hair care in strikingly different ways. The main issue for hair care in 2020 was that there was a very sudden change in Dutch consumers’ personal care routine in general.
